Are there any exams or assessments for the Qcf Level 3 Diploma in Introduction to Management qualification?

Yes, there are exams and assessments that need to be completed in order to obtain the QCF Level 3 Diploma in Introduction to Management qualification. This qualification is designed to provide learners with the skills and knowledge needed to work in a management role.

The assessments for this qualification typically include a combination of written exams, practical assessments, and coursework. These assessments are designed to test the learner's understanding of key management concepts and their ability to apply them in a real-world setting.
